Eureka Bet Casino Megaways Low Wagering Offer Exposes the Real Cost of “Easy Wins”

Why the Wagering Condition Matters More Than the Bonus Size

When a promotion advertises a 100% match up to $500 but tacks on a 5x wagering requirement, the effective value drops to roughly $100 after a diligent player calculates the necessary turnover. Compare that to a 3x requirement on a $200 match, where the total bet needed is $600, delivering a 33% higher net return. The difference is not abstract; it directly impacts bankroll sustainability. Practical Pitfalls of “Low Wagering” Megaways Deals

First, game eligibility restrictions. Many low-wagering offers exclude high-RTP titles, meaning the advertised “low-wagering” label becomes misleading. For example, a $25 bonus with 2x wagering might only apply to slots with RTP below 95%, effectively pushing players toward lower-paying games. If the player’s favourite is a 96.5% RTP slot, they must either forfeit the bonus or accept less favourable odds.

Second, the turnover calculation often counts “real money” bets only. If a player uses free spins from a separate promotion, those spins do not count toward the wagering total, effectively extending the required playtime by up to 30%. This additional cost is frequently missed in initial offer summaries.

Third, the withdrawal threshold. Some operators, such as Jackpot City Casino, set a minimum cashout of $20 after a bonus is cleared. If the net win after meeting the wagering requirement is $15, the player cannot withdraw and must continue playing, re-entering the wagering cycle. The extra $5 becomes an implicit cost of the “low-wagering” promise.

Comparing the Offer to Traditional Bonus Structures

A traditional 10x wagering on a $200 match forces a $2,000 turnover, which, for a player betting $20 per session, translates to ten sessions. By contrast, a “low-wagering” 2x on a $100 match forces $200 turnover – a mere two sessions at the same stake. However, the low-wagering promo often includes a tighter cashout cap, meaning the maximum profit a player can extract is lower. The trade-off is essentially between speed and profit ceiling.
